Chess Puzzle #PkGqH — Advanced, Black to move, middlegame

Rating 1828 · Advanced · crushing, kingside attack, long, middlegame.

Position

White: king g1; queen c2; rooks a1/e1; bishop b3; pawns a2/b2/c3/f2/g2/h2. Black: king g7; queen f5; rooks d8/e8; knight e4; pawns a7/b7/c6/f7/g6/h7. Material is balanced. Black to move.

Solution (3 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: f3 — pawn f2→f3. Now Black to move.
  2. Best move: Qc5+ — queen f5→c5, gives check. Opponent replies Kh1 (king g1→h1).
  3. Best move: Nf2+ — knight e4→f2, gives check. Opponent replies Qxf2 (queen c2→f2, captures knight).
  4. Best move: Qxf2 — queen c5→f2, captures queen.

Tactical themes

crushing, kingside attack, long, middlegame. The key move is Qc5+.
